Ocean Construction, B General Building Contractor in San Jose, CA
Ocean Construction operating as a corporation hol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1068907), valid through Sep 30, 2026. First issued in 2020,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 6 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: B — General Building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with North River Insurance Company (the) and a previously-filed workers' compensation policy with National Liability and Fire Insurance Company that is no longer active. The business is based in San Jose, in Santa Clara County, California.
